Improving Phlebotomist Fatigue with Better-Designed Equipment
One specific issue that hospitals need to address is reducing phlebotomist fatigue by investing in better-designed equipment. Phlebotomists play a crucial role in healthcare settings by collecting blood samples for diagnostic testing, but the repetitive nature of their work can lead to musculoskeletal injuries and fatigue. By implementing ergonomic equipment and work practices, hospitals can reduce the risk of injury and improve the well-being of their staff.
Key Strategies for Addressing Phlebotomist Fatigue
To reduce phlebotomist fatigue, hospitals can implement the following strategies:
- Investing in ergonomic phlebotomy chairs and workstations that support proper posture and minimize strain on the body.
- Providing training on proper blood collection techniques and ergonomic practices to reduce the risk of injury.
- Using innovative blood collection devices that are designed to be more comfortable and user-friendly for phlebotomists.
Benefits of Reducing Phlebotomist Fatigue
By addressing phlebotomist fatigue and ensuring the well-being of healthcare workers, hospitals can experience several benefits, including:
- Reduced staff turnover and absenteeism due to injuries and fatigue.
- Improved patient care and satisfaction as phlebotomists can perform their duties more effectively and efficiently.
- Enhanced overall productivity and cost-effectiveness by minimizing the impact of injuries and fatigue on staffing levels.
Optimizing Supply Chain Processes for Better Inventory Management
In addition to addressing issues such as phlebotomist fatigue, hospitals can improve supply and equipment management by optimizing their Supply Chain processes. By implementing best practices in inventory management, procurement, and distribution, hospitals can streamline operations and reduce costs while ensuring the availability of necessary supplies.
Key Strategies for Optimizing Supply Chain Processes
Some key strategies for optimizing Supply Chain processes in hospital settings include:
- Implementing automated inventory management systems to track supplies and equipment in real-time and prevent stockouts.
- Establishing strong relationships with suppliers to improve pricing, quality, and lead times for deliveries.
- Standardizing supply ordering and replenishment processes to reduce waste and ensure consistency across departments.
Benefits of Optimizing Supply Chain Processes
By optimizing Supply Chain processes, hospitals can experience several benefits, including:
- Reduced costs through better inventory control, pricing negotiation, and waste reduction.
- Improved efficiency and productivity as staff can spend less time managing supplies and more time on patient care.
- Enhanced patient safety and satisfaction by ensuring the availability of necessary supplies and equipment when needed.
